Adam Suleiman Kalungi, the alleged boyfriend of the deceased Butaleja Woman MP, Cerinah Nebanda has been arrested by the police of Kenya.
Kalungi was arrested by the Kenyan police but has since been deported back to Uganda through the Malaba border in Tororo district and is being held by Ugandan police at the moment.

Kalungi is said to have fled to Kenya on 14th December 2012, the same day that Nebanda died. He was among the three people who took the deceased to Mukwaya hospital where she was declared dead upon arrival. He has been on the most wanted list of police in connection to the death of the 24-year-old.
Deputy Police spokesperson, Vincet Ssekatte confirmed the arrest saying Kalungi was apprehended by the Kenyan authorities and handed over to the Ugandan police immediately afterwards. “The government of Kenya caught Kalungi in Kenya and was deported to Uganda through the Malaba boarder in Tororo district,” Sekatte said. He went on to add saying, “Kalunig ran from Uganda since 14th December and has been in hiding ever since. His arrest is not only beneficial because he was the last person to see Nebanda alive but because he can fill in the very many blanks in the story. He will tell us what happened, how it happened, he will tell us the details of Nebanda before she died.”
Sekatte went on to thank the Kenyan police for handing over Kalungi to the Ugandan authorities. He did not reveal however where exactly Kalungi is being held at the moment.
